The Ride Sharing Market is projected to grow from USD 119.1 billion in 2026 to USD 283.0 billion by 2035, at a CAGR of 10.1%. Mobility sharing solutions are integrated mobility platforms that provide users with access to diverse transportation options through unified digital interfaces, enabling seamless, convenient travel experiences while promoting sustainable transport choices. The market is driven by urbanization, sustainability, and digital innovation.
The mobility sharing solutions market is currently experiencing a transformative phase driven by urbanization, sustainability, and digital innovation. By service type, the market includes Ride-Hailing, Ride Pooling, Car Rental / Subscription, and Micro-Transit / Shuttle, with ride-hailing holding the largest revenue share at approximately 62% of the market. By application, the market serves Personal Mobility, Corporate / Enterprise, and Government / Public Transit Integration, with government and public transit integration gaining traction as cities incorporate shared mobility into public transportation networks. By vehicle propulsion, the market includes ICE Vehicles, Battery Electric Vehicles, and Hybrid Vehicles, with electric vehicle fleet transitions accelerating due to emissions regulations. North America commands roughly 38% of the global Ride Sharing Market. Asia-Pacific is the fastest-growing region at a projected CAGR of 12.6%. Europe holds approximately 25% share. As autonomous robotaxi ride sharing scales from pilot to commercial deployment, the Ride Sharing Market stands at an inflection point that will redefine urban mobility through 2035. Key players include Uber Technologies, DiDi Global, Lyft, Grab Holdings, Bolt, and Ola Cabs.
